- TriviaTrixie mentions that she only remembers one other newborn abandoned in Poplar. This occurred in the Christmas Special (2012).
- GoofsEpisode 9.1 is set at the time of Winston Churchill's death in February 1965 and features "Turn, Turn,Turn" by The Byrds, released in October 1965.
